The Anatomy of the Perfect Taquito: Ingredients You’ll Need

To achieve professional-grade results at home, the quality of your ingredients matters. We recommend using a rotisserie chicken—a beloved American “shortcut” that provides tender, well-seasoned meat that shreds easily. For the cheese, a blend of sharp cheddar and spicy Pepper Jack provides both flavor and that essential “cheese pull” we all love.

Filling Ingredients (The Taquito Core)

Ingredient Amount (US Standard) Expert Note
Shredded Chicken 1 ½ cups Use rotisserie chicken for extra tenderness.
Cream Cheese 4 ounces Ensure it is softened at room temperature.
Buffalo Sauce 1/3 cup Frank’s RedHot is the traditional choice.
Pepper Jack Cheese 1 cup Shred it fresh for better melting.
Fresh Jalapeño 1 large Deseeded for mild, seeds kept for heat.
Pickled Jalapeños 2 tablespoons Adds a vital tangy acidity to the filling.
Corn Tortillas 16–20 small Yellow or white corn works perfectly.

The Sauce: Creamy Cilantro Ranch Ingredients

No Buffalo-themed dish is complete without a cooling dip. While traditional wings use blue cheese, the Mexican-American fusion of the taquito calls for a zesty, herby ranch. By using Greek yogurt as a base, we add a healthy probiotic boost and a pleasant tang that cuts through the spice.

  • Base: ½ cup plain Greek yogurt (or sour cream) and ½ cup buttermilk.
  • Fresh Herbs: ¼ cup chopped parsley, ¼ cup chopped cilantro, and 2 tbsp fresh dill.
  • Seasoning: 1 tsp garlic powder, 1 tsp onion powder, and sea salt to taste.

Step-by-Step Guide to Rolling and Baking Like a Pro

The biggest challenge home cooks face with taquitos is the “tortilla crack.” Follow these steps precisely to ensure your Buffalo Chicken Taquitos stay intact and look as good as they taste.

Step 1: The Filling Preparation

In a large mixing bowl, combine your shredded chicken, room-temperature cream cheese, and Buffalo sauce. Using a sturdy spatula, fold in the shredded Pepper Jack, fresh jalapeños, pickled jalapeños, cilantro, and green onions. Mixing thoroughly is key here; you want every bite to have a consistent ratio of chicken, sauce, and cheese. If you prefer a smoother texture, you can even use a hand mixer to slightly “whip” the cream cheese into the chicken.

Step 2: The Tortilla Science (Avoiding the Crack)

Pro Tip: Corn tortillas are notorious for cracking when cold. To make them flexible, place a stack of 5–6 tortillas between two damp paper towels and microwave them for 45 seconds. This creates a “steam room” effect that makes the corn pliable and easy to roll.

Step 3: Assembly and Rolling

Lay a warm tortilla on a clean surface. Lightly brush the outward-facing side with olive oil or spray with a high-heat cooking spray. Flip it over and place about 2 tablespoons of the filling in a line just off-center. Roll the tortilla as tightly as possible. Placing them seam-side down on your baking sheet is non-negotiable—this uses the weight of the filling to “seal” the taquito as it bakes.

Step 4: The High-Heat Bake

Preheat your oven to 425°F (218°C). This high temperature is what mimics the effect of a deep fryer, evaporating moisture quickly and crisping the corn. Bake for 8 minutes, then remove the tray and carefully flip each taquito using tongs. Bake for another 5–7 minutes until the edges are dark golden brown and you see a tiny bit of cheese bubbling out of the ends.

Mastering the Creamy Cilantro Ranch

While your taquitos are crisping in the oven, it’s time to assemble the sauce. This isn’t your average bottled dressing; it’s a vibrant, living sauce that elevates the entire meal.

Whisking vs. Blending

For a rustic, chunky dip, simply whisk all the ingredients together in a bowl. However, for a gourmet restaurant finish, we recommend using a blender or food processor. Blending the fresh cilantro and parsley directly into the yogurt and buttermilk turns the sauce a beautiful pale green and ensures the herb oils are fully emulsified into the dip.

  • Consistency Tip: If the sauce is too thick, add buttermilk one teaspoon at a time until it reaches your desired “drizzle” consistency.
  • Make-Ahead: This sauce actually tastes better after sitting in the fridge for 30 minutes, allowing the dried garlic and onion powders to rehydrate.

Expert Tips for Success

  • Don’t Overfill: It is tempting to pack these with chicken, but overfilling will cause the tortillas to burst in the oven. Stick to the 2-tablespoon rule.
  • Use the Right Oil: Avocado oil or light olive oil works best. Avoid extra virgin olive oil for this recipe as its smoke point is too low for a 425°F oven.
  • The Cooling Rack Trick: For maximum crunch, place a wire cooling rack on top of your baking sheet and arrange the taquitos on the rack. This allows hot air to circulate under the taquitos, crisping the bottom without the need for flipping.

Variations for Every Diet

At Cook with Feast, we want everyone to enjoy our recipes. Here is how you can adapt this dish to fit different needs:

Variation Substitution
Vegetarian Swap chicken for shredded Jackfruit or black beans.
Extra Spicy Add ½ tsp of cayenne pepper or use “Extra Hot” Buffalo sauce.
Flour Tortilla Use small flour tortillas for a “flauta” style (softer bite).
Gluten-Free Standard corn tortillas are usually GF, but check labels for cross-contamination.

Nutritional Breakdown (Per Serving)

This recipe makes roughly 18 taquitos. A standard serving of 3 taquitos provides a balanced profile of fats, proteins, and carbohydrates, making it a surprisingly complete snack or meal.

Nutritional Note: By baking instead of frying, you save approximately 150 calories and 15g of fat per serving compared to traditional restaurant taquitos.

  • Calories: 340 kcal per 3 taquitos.
  • Protein: 22g (Great for post-workout or growing kids).
  • Carbs: 26g (Low-glycemic energy from corn).
  • Fat: 16g (Primarily from the cream cheese and yogurt).

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make these Buffalo Chicken Taquitos in an air fryer?

Yes, the air fryer is actually one of the best ways to cook these! Simply place the Buffalo Chicken Taquitos in a single layer in the air fryer basket (do not overcrowd). Spray lightly with oil and cook at 400°F (200°C) for 6–8 minutes, flipping halfway through, until the corn tortillas are golden and shatteringly crisp.

What is the best way to prevent corn tortillas from cracking?

Corn tortillas crack when they are dry and cold. To make them pliable, wrap a stack of 5–6 tortillas in a damp paper towel and microwave them for about 45 seconds. This steams the corn, making the taquitos much easier to roll tightly without the edges splitting open during the baking process.

Can I freeze these taquitos for later?

Absolutely! These are excellent for meal prep. Assemble the taquitos but do not bake them. Place them on a baking sheet in the freezer for one hour to “flash freeze,” then transfer them to a freezer-safe bag. When you’re ready to eat, you can bake them directly from frozen—just add an extra 5 minutes to the total baking time.
